STATUS OF EMRSs IN WEST BENGAL

The Ministry of Tribal Affairs is implementing the Eklavya Model Residential School (EMRS) scheme to deliver quality education to tribal students while preserving local art and culture. EMRSs are set up in blocks with >50% ST population and at least 20,000 tribal persons (Census 2011). Nationwide, 728 EMRSs have been approved, of which 508 are functional. In West Bengal, 9 EMRSs have been approved and all are functional; none of the blocks in Alipurduar meet the criteria. The autonomous National Education Society for Tribal Students (NESTS) oversees policy and implementation, with State Societies and District Committees handling local administration. District‑wise enrolment for 2025‑26 totals 3,152 students across the nine functional schools.
